Moving from Wayne County, MI to Essex County, NJ is estimated to cost $15,372 more per year. To maintain similar purchasing power, a $50,000 salary in Wayne County, MI would need to be about $67,950 in Essex County, NJ. The biggest increase is housing, followed by taxes.
This is a 35.9% increase in modeled annual costs. Housing is $6,091 per year higher (54.64%); Taxes is $3,794 per year higher (51.28%).
Below we break down the annual categories behind the difference using Economic Policy Institute 2026 Family Budget data.

In Essex County, NJ, modeled annual costs are $58,196 compared with $42,824 in Wayne County, MI.
